  • And if the computer gives you any back talk, pour some well-sugared office coffee into its evil little silicon brain.

  • Our culture runs on coffee and gasoline, the first often tasting like the second.

    "Down the River". Book by Edward Abbey, 1982.
  • Cold morning on Aztec Peak Fire Lookout. First, build fire in old stove. Second, start coffee. Then, heat up last night's pork chops and spinach for breakfast. Why not? And why the hell not?

    Edward Abbey (2015). “A Voice Crying in the Wilderness”, p.16, RosettaBooks
